Latest Patents: Among his latest innovations is a patent titled "System and Method for Intent-Based Service Deployment." This patent describes a non-transitory computer-readable storage medium that contains computer-executable instructions. When executed by a processor, these instructions enable the processor to receive an indicator of functionality. The system then maps this indicator to a first and a second service based on the dependencies, identifies relevant policies associated with these services, and determines optimal deployment locations for both services. This groundbreaking approach enhances the efficiency and flexibility of service deployment in various applications.
